History & Origin
Tory is a pet form of Victoria — from Latin victoria, 'victory' — and also of names like Tor or Salvatore, and an English surname (routes layered, which we note). A crisp, sunny name, used for both sexes, here for girls (slug distinguished; the spelling Tori is also common; nickname Tor).
It registers thinly in records. Rare, victory at the root, and sunny.
